patch 9.1.0158: 'shortmess' "F" flag doesn't work properly with 'autoread'
Problem: 'shortmess' "F" flag doesn't work properly with 'autoread'
(after 9.1.0154)
Solution: Hide the file info message instead of the warning dialog
(zeertzjq)
closes: #14159
closes: #14158
